首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当LayoutDirection设置为rtl时,ActionLayout不显示

当LayoutDirection设置为rtl(从右到左)时,ActionLayout不显示的问题可能是由于以下原因导致的:

  1. 布局方向导致的问题:当布局方向设置为rtl时,布局中的元素会从右到左进行排列。如果ActionLayout的位置在布局的左侧,可能会被隐藏或者被其他元素遮挡,导致不显示。此时,可以尝试将ActionLayout的位置调整到布局的右侧,或者使用其他布局方式来解决。
  2. 布局属性设置错误:可能是由于ActionLayout的布局属性设置错误导致不显示。请确保ActionLayout的布局属性(如layout_width、layout_height、layout_gravity等)正确设置,并且与父布局的属性相匹配。
  3. 布局层级问题:如果ActionLayout被放置在了较低的布局层级中,可能会被其他元素遮挡而不显示。请检查布局层级,确保ActionLayout位于正确的位置。
  4. 其他因素:除了上述原因外,还可能存在其他因素导致ActionLayout不显示,例如代码逻辑错误、样式设置问题等。建议仔细检查代码,并进行逐步调试,以确定具体原因。

针对这个问题,腾讯云提供了一系列的云计算产品和解决方案,可以帮助开发者构建稳定、高效的云计算环境。具体推荐的产品和产品介绍链接如下:

  1. 云服务器(ECS):提供弹性计算能力,可根据业务需求灵活调整计算资源。了解更多: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高可用、可扩展的关系型数据库服务,适用于各类应用场景。了解更多:https://cloud.tencent.com/product/cdb_mysql
  3. 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署和管理容器化应用。了解更多:https://cloud.tencent.com/product/tke
  4. 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,帮助开发者构建智能化应用。了解更多:https://cloud.tencent.com/product/ailab

请注意,以上推荐的产品仅作为参考,具体选择应根据实际需求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

车机Android开发:切换阿拉伯语UI遇到问题

问题前状态 在进行更改之前,中文语UI显示是正常。 遇到的问题 切换到阿拉伯语UI后,PIP的位置显示不正确。...第一种方法:处理XML布局 我首先尝试通过修改XML布局文件来解决问题,设置layoutDirection属性rtl: <FrameLayout android:layoutDirection...pip_height" android:layout_marginTop="@dimen/x60" android:background="@drawable/bg_pip" /> 别忘了还需要设置在... 那么只处理了xml的layoutDirection就可以生效嘛?答复是“NO"....总结 总之,在开发一个面向全球的App,我们要考虑的是文字翻译那么简单。想想看,每个地区的用户习惯都不一样,就像我们家里的布局和邻居的可能会完全相反。

35040
  • 【CSS】盒子模型内边距 ⑤ ( 内边距不影响盒子模型尺寸的情况 | 设置宽度或高度设置 Padding 内边距撑开盒子 )

    文章目录 一、内边距不影响盒子模型尺寸的情况 二、内边距影响盒子模型尺寸的情况 一、内边距不影响盒子模型尺寸的情况 ---- 如果元素没有指定高度 , 该元素设置 Padding 内边距 , 则不会撑开盒子...; 下面的代码中 , 父容器是 div , 子容器是 p , p 标签的宽度默认充满父容器 , 如果没有为其设置父容器的宽度 , p 标签设置 内边距 , 不会撑开盒子 ; 代码示例 : <!...具体的尺寸 , 设置 Padding 内边距 , 会撑开盒子 ; 代码示例 : <!...padding-left: 50px; } 内边距不影响盒子模型尺寸的情况 显示效果...: 测量宽度 : p 标签 内容宽度 200 像素 , 设置左内边距 , 水平方向上撑开了 50 像素 , 最终盒子宽度 250 像素 ; 测量高度 : 没有设置 垂直方向 上的内边距 , 没有撑开效果

    1.4K20

    Android 面试题之TextView 的textDirection属性和右对齐问题

    默认行为 textDirection 的默认值: 默认情况下,TextView的文本方向是由系统自动设置的。具体而言,它默认的方向是 TEXT_DIRECTION_FIRST_STRONG。...如果第一个强方向性字符属于一种从右到左(RTL)语言,那么文本的方向将是从右到左。 layoutDirection 的默认值: 布局方向通常依赖于应用的区域设置(locale)和设备的语言设置。...如果区域设置或设备语言是RTL语言(比如阿拉伯语或希伯来语),那么布局方向会自动调整RTL,否则为LTR。...开启右语言 启用RTL支持: 确保应用全局支持RTL方向,可以在AndroidManifest.xml文件中的 标签中添加: <application ......,比如是写死的中文,那TextView就不会按照右语言来处理了,这个时候就需要为TextView设置textDirection属性,有2种方式 直接布局里设置android:textDirection=

    18810

    Qt编写数据可视化大屏界面电子看板3-新建布局

    函数直接保存当前窗体的所有布局位置大小等信息到配置文件,至于配置文件的内容格式,那是人类无法理解的格式,反正我是看不懂,这些都没有关系的,你重新用restoreState()函数加载读取配置文件的信息,...可设置标题+目标分辨率+布局方案,启动立即应用。 可设置主背景颜色+面板颜色+十字线游标颜色。 可设置多条曲线颜色,没有设置颜色的情况下内置15套精美颜色随机应用。 可设置标题栏背景颜色+文字颜色。...可设置标题栏高度+表头高度+行高度。 曲线支持游标+悬停高亮数据点和显示值,柱状图支持顶部(可设置顶端+上部+中间+底部)显示数据,全部自适应计算位置。...在模块的标题栏上右键可以弹出默认的dock菜单,用来显示和隐藏各模块。 软件关闭过程中会自动保存布局,下次启动以后自动应用。...+选中配置文件对应菜单 actionLayout = menuLayout->actions(); foreach (QAction *action, actionLayout) {

    1K60

    Android屏幕旋转之横屏竖屏切换的实现

    用户和重力传感器共同决定是哪个方向的横屏 SCREEN_ORIENTATION_USER_PORTRAIT 用户和重力传感器共同决定是哪个方向的竖屏 UIOPTION_SPLIT_ACTION_BAR_WHEN_NARROW 屏幕较窄导航栏有一部分会显示在底部...layoutDirection 布局方向变化。...我想要实现的是打开“屏幕旋转”,App内的Activity跟随重力感应器;当关闭“屏幕旋转”,App内的Activity固定为默认方向。如何做到关闭重力传感器,App亦关闭屏幕自动旋转?...android:screenOrientation="sensor" 改上述代码以下代码 android:screenOrientation="user" 意即:参数sensor,无论是否关闭“...参数user“屏幕旋转”开启,则特定Activity根据根据重力传感器改变横竖屏;“屏幕旋转”关闭,则特定Activity会固定位默认方向(一般正面竖屏)。

    6.9K40

    NestedScrolling机制之CoordinatorLayout.Behavior实战

    (goodViewTop); return true; } return super.onLayoutChild(parent, child, layoutDirection...coordinatorLayout 同上 * child 同上 * target 同上 * velocityX 水平加速度 * velocityY 竖直加速度 * consumed 同上 false拦截.../** * CoordinatorLayout绘制child的时候调用 * parent 同上 * child 同上 * CoordinatorLayout布局解析的方法 0=ltr 1=rtl,因为有些国家是从左向右显示的...**/ boolean onLayoutChild(@NonNull CoordinatorLayout parent, @NonNull GoodsListView child, int layoutDirection...onStopNestedScroll():看名字就知道了,停止滑动时调用的方法,主要是执行当滑到一般停止要怎么恢复还是隐藏商品列表的判断 onNestedFling(): 手指快速一划所触发的方法

    87110

    连Action Bar都不会 你能说你学过 Android?

    action_hide = (Button) findViewById(R.id.actionBar_hide); //获取隐藏按钮 action_show.setOnClickListener(l); //显示按钮设置监听事件...action_hide.setOnClickListener(l); //隐藏按钮设置监听事件 } ---- 本文原创首发CSDN,链接 https://blog.csdn.net/qq_41464123...如果是 always ,则默认显示; 如果是 ifRoom,Action Bar上有空则显示; 如果是 never,则默认隐藏到三个点区域里面; 显示效果如下图: 隐藏Item,点击三个点图标后,可以显示...; android:icon是没被隐藏显示的图标 如果只有android:title,但没有android:icon,被强制显示,Action Bar会显示文字,如下图所示: 如果只有android...: 注意4:app:actionLayout 指的是通过Layout文件,添加 Action Bar Item项 如XML文件定义一个图片 <?

    30320

    # Flutter组件基础——Text

    TextDirectionrtl即(right-to-left),start和end的含义和left、right相反。...最大行数maxLines 注意iOS中设置label不限行数是设置numberOfLines=0,但Flutter中最大行数maxLines不能为0,如果设置不限行数,设置这个属性即可。...超出显示overFlow overFlow类似于iOS中的lineBreakMode,设置超出指定行数之后的显示方式:截断、省略......需要注意的是,是超出指定行数之后的显示,所以需要先设置maxLines,如果设置,默认是无限行,设置这个属性就没有意义。...此处需要注意,overFlowfade设置softWrapfalse与设置的效果,设置阴影效果方向从上到下,设置了之后阴影效果超出的尾部,见下图。

    1.3K30

    优化 FPGA HLS 设计

    优化 FPGA HLS 设计 用工具用 C 生成 RTL 的代码基本不可读。以下是如何在更改任何 RTL 的情况下提高设计性能。 介绍 高级设计能够以简洁的方式捕获设计,从而减少错误并更容易调试。...高效找到正确的 FPGA 工具设置 尽管设计人员知道 FPGA 工具设置的存在,但这些设置往往没有得到充分利用。通常,只有在出现设计问题才使用工具设置。...导出到 RTL 项目 在更改 C++ 代码的情况下,将设计导出到 RTL 中的 Vivado 项目中。在“解决方案”下,选择“导出 RTL”。...提示要使用的 Vivado 版本,请使用“相同”的 Vivado 版本。例如,如果使用2017.3 HLS,请使用2017.3 Vivado。 选择“热启动”。...这是一种迭代优化,只要每次迭代都显示出改进,就会不断重复。如果达到时间目标或未能显示出改进,它最终将自动停止。 经过两轮优化,共15次编译,该设计能够满足200Mhz的性能目标。

    27231

    Python Qt GUI设计:UI界面可视化组件、属性概述(基础篇—3)

    sizePolicy属性 sizePolicy属性用于说明组件在布局管理中的缩放方式,部件没有在布局管理器中,该设置无效。...启用的情况下,对应部件只接收在鼠标移动同时至少一个鼠标按键按下的鼠标移动事件,启用鼠标跟踪的情况下,任何鼠标移动事件部件都会接收。...启用平板跟踪的情况下,部件仅接收触控笔与平板接触或至少有个触控笔按键按下的触控笔移动事件。...对于大多数小部件,无需设置此属性,因为Qt会调用部件相关属性显示,如按钮将显示按钮的文本,但小部件不提供任何文本设置此属性很重要。例如,只包含图标的按钮需要将此属性设置与屏幕阅读器一起使用。...窗口没有设置标题属性的情况下,则窗口标题展示展示windowFilePath对应的文件名的信息(路径信息展示),如果二者都设置,则优先使用窗口标题属性的设置作为标题。

    5.6K50

    针对 CoordinatorLayout 及 Behavior 的一次细节较真

    与前面的 NestedScroll 相似,我们可以在 fling 动作即将发生,通过 onNestedPreFling 获知,如果在这个方法返回值 true 的话会怎么样?...这个实验的目的是 MyBehavior 响应 fling 动作,如果滑动方向向下,ImageView 就放大。反之缩小到原先的大小。... Behavior 中的 View 准备响应嵌套滑动,它不需要通过 layoutDependsOn() 来进行依赖绑定。...返回值 true ,后续的滑动事件才能被响应。 嵌套滑动包括滑动(scroll) 和 快速滑动(fling) 两种情况。开发者根据实际情况运用就好了。...= ViewCompat.getLayoutDirection(this); final boolean isRtl = layoutDirection == ViewCompat.LAYOUT_DIRECTION_RTL

    1.2K20

    安卓中activity的生命周期_activity生命周期调用顺序

    此时Activity显示到前台。 (5)onPause:表示Activity正在停止,此时可以做一些存储数据、停止动画等操作,但不宜太耗时。...重建,系统会在onStart之后调用onRestoreInstanceState,销毁onSaveInstanceState所保存的Bundle对象作为参数传给onRestoreInstanceState...(2)其中用的比较多的另两个属性locale、keyboardHidden。前者设备的本地位置发生了改变,一般指切换了系统语言。后者一般指用户调出了键盘。...(3)screenSize属性和smallestScreenSize属性比较特殊,他们是API13添加的。分别表示的情况屏幕尺寸发生变化和切换到外部显示设备。...(4)Android4.2增加了一个layoutDirection属性,改变语言设置后,该属性也会成newConfig中的一个mask位。

    85910

    一个HLS Stream应用案例

    image.png 第二步,设置任何directive,直接执行C综合,此时会显示如下错误信息。...之后,重新执行C综合和C/RTL Cosimulation,均可通过。 ? ? 第三步,进一步优化,可以看到这两个底层函数是可以应用dataflow以降低latency。具体设置如图7所示。...执行C综合,综合结束时会显示如图8所示信息。...如果只设置DATAFLOW,而设置FIFO深度,C综合是可以通过的,但执行C/RTL Cosimulation,会显示如图10所示错误信息。可以判断与FIFO的读写相关。...从这个案例我们可以得出如下结论: -流用于内部函数间的参数传递,会被综合为深度1的FIFO -流数据被综合为FIFO,由于默认深度1,可能会在C/RTLCosimulation出现DEADLOCK

    1.5K10
    领券